I agree with BABRTs and I would also consider backgouging the internal nozzle neck to shell interface to verify you have a full penetration weld in that area. A lot of nozzles were put in and more of a fillet weld was on the nozzle to shell joint than a full pen weld. Where they have been cut and ground flush you may have very little weld metal in that joint and you will want a good weld where you join your new to old or you may have a leaker when you do you air soap test.
